Dreaming of riches and dominating the sea is all you ever wanted. But it is very hard to do when your an ugly spud!


​Potato Pirates has a collection of them and you are responsible for keeping them a float. 

You'll have 2 ships, loaded up with potatoes. Ten of them each. If you loose them and there are no crew members aboard a vessel, it sinks.
Picture

​Players are going to be drawing cards every turn and adding them to their docked ships. These cards will be "action" cards, that will do damage to a target ship. In one's, two's and three's..."That's not a lot of damage", you say.

That's where the "control" cards come into play. These can also be loaded onto the ships to increase your attack. They will either multiply the "action" cards, give conditions for the use of the "action" cards or set a programmed pattern en route for the "action" cards. These will give different attacks to your enemies, hopefully eliminating them. Making you the soul survivor, winning the game.

Or  you could collect all 7 of the Potato Kings, also winning you the game. Every time you have a King in you hand, you place it in front of you. The other players have to show their respects and salute you. Being the slowest to do so will cost you two of you potato crew, as they defect to the side of the Potato King. Kings can be found, stolen and  collected throughout the game.

​
Picture
"Surprise" cards are also thrown into the mix to block attacks, gain new cards and ship. And deny someone who denies you. Giving you a family fun, take that style of game, that also teaches math and programming.

HOW WAS THE WEST WON...?


​Well it wasn't by drawing fastest or by scaring the the tribesmen away. It was done at a table, with two players and box of cardboard.
Picture
This is Outlaws, a Kickstarter from Holy Grail Games. Where one box will bring dual-ling fun for two players. And two boxes will extend that pleasure to four.

Everyone is trying to get their Governor to be elected...well, as Governor of a small western town, where cowboys wear hats and dead men wear no plaid. If you successfully get more votes than the other player, you win the game...Simple, eh!

But each player also has a, so crooked, he could swallow nails and spit out corkscrews, Hitmam who can take out that pretty dressed, ladies man. If he can find him, that is. And when the hit is done, and your Governor the only one in town, you'll win.

...Unless, the Sheriff finds this critter and arrests him. ​


​So, we have a back and forth, two player game that plays quicker than a man could eat his hat. With three different ways to win. 
 And a selection of characters, each with their own special powers (and more Kickstarter exclusive characters too) to help you deduce and bluff your way to the top. You'll also have to have something under your hat, other than your hair, to remember where voting slips are and the whereabouts of certain persons. ​
